Is a Safari Safe? Complete Safety Guide for Africa

One of the most common questions first-time safari travellers ask is whether it is safe. The short answer is yes — safaris are among the safest and most controlled travel experiences in the world when done properly. This guide addresses the real safety picture, from wildlife encounters to health and security, so you can plan with confidence.

Wildlife Safety and Expert Guiding

Wildlife encounters are carefully managed. Professional guides are trained, armed where required and skilled at reading animal behaviour. You stay in a vehicle or follow strict protocols on walking safaris. Attacks are extraordinarily rare, and incidents almost always involve people ignoring rules or travelling without proper guidance.

Accommodation and Camp Security

Safari lodges and camps prioritise guest safety with perimeter fencing where appropriate, armed security at night and staff escorts after dark. Many camps sit within fenced reserves or private concessions where dangerous animals are monitored closely. Your safety is planned into every detail.

Health Precautions

Health risks are real but manageable. Malaria prevention, vaccinations and travel insurance are standard precautions. Reputable camps have first-aid trained staff, medical kits and evacuation plans. Food and water safety is taken seriously, and you are far more likely to face minor issues like a cold than anything serious.

Crime and Personal Security

Tourist areas, lodges and reserves are generally very safe. Petty crime exists in cities, but safari camps and parks have minimal risk. Use hotel safes, avoid displaying valuables in urban areas and travel with registered operators. The overwhelming majority of travellers experience zero security issues.

Choosing Reputable Operators

The single biggest safety factor is your choice of operator. Established companies with professional guides, proper insurance and safety protocols ensure your trip runs smoothly. Avoid unregistered or suspiciously cheap offers, and ask about guide qualifications, vehicle standards and emergency procedures.
